The Captivating World of Benny Griessel
Benny Griessel is a complex and deeply flawed protagonist, haunted by personal demons and a desire for redemption. As a detective in the Cape Town police force, he battles substance abuse and self-destructive tendencies while navigating the treacherous waters of organized crime and political intrigue. Despite his inner struggles, Benny possesses an unwavering determination and a deep empathy for the victims he encounters.

A Thrilling Literary Journey
Deon Meyer's Benny Griessel Mysteries are not merely crime novels; they are literary explorations of South Africa's social and political upheavals. Meyer deftly weaves intricate plots that expose the corrupt institutions, racial tensions, and economic disparities that plague post-apartheid South Africa. Through the eyes of Benny Griessel, readers witness the aftermath of apartheid and its lingering impact on the nation's psyche.
